solana-program-library/account-compression/sdk
Noah Gundotra 39935bab12
ac: expose ChangeLogEventV1 in crate (#3707)
2022-10-12 19:01:42 -04:00
..
idl ac: expose ChangeLogEventV1 in crate (#3707) 2022-10-12 19:01:42 -04:00
src Account Compression: 0.1.2 release (#3672) 2022-10-06 11:58:16 -05:00
tests Account Compression: 0.1.2 release (#3672) 2022-10-06 11:58:16 -05:00
.gitignore Account Compression: Version ChangeLog + Test (#3632) 2022-09-22 15:05:24 -04:00
.npmignore Account Compression: Version ChangeLog + Test (#3632) 2022-09-22 15:05:24 -04:00
.solitarc.js Account Compression: Version ChangeLog + Test (#3632) 2022-09-22 15:05:24 -04:00
README.md Account Compression: Autogenerate TS SDK with Solita (#3551) 2022-09-08 17:04:54 +05:30
jest.config.js Account Compression: Autogenerate TS SDK with Solita (#3551) 2022-09-08 17:04:54 +05:30
package.json Account Compression: Version ChangeLog + Test (#3632) 2022-09-22 15:05:24 -04:00
tsconfig.base.json SPL Account Compression JS Package (#3609) 2022-09-16 15:56:31 -04:00
tsconfig.cjs.json SPL Account Compression JS Package (#3609) 2022-09-16 15:56:31 -04:00
tsconfig.json SPL Account Compression JS Package (#3609) 2022-09-16 15:56:31 -04:00
yarn.lock AC: version on-chain accounts (#3619) 2022-09-21 09:16:11 -04:00

README.md

Account Compression SDK

Currently contains a typescript SDK to interact with on-chain SPL ConcurrentMerkleTrees.

Used to test Account Compression program.

Setting up the Solita-based Typescript SDK

  1. Generate the Solita SDK with yarn solita.

  2. Then build the SDK with yarn build.

Testing the SDK

Run yarn test. Expect jest to detect an open handle that prevents it from exiting tests naturally.